Scientific or Theoretical Perspective

From a scientific standpoint, the Neuroscience: Exploring the Brain Enhanced Edition PDF embodies current best practices in science education research. Cognitive science research has consistently shown that people learn most effectively when information is presented through multiple sensory channels simultaneously – a principle known as dual coding theory. The enhanced PDF format leverages this principle by combining textual explanations with visual, auditory, and interactive elements that engage multiple cognitive pathways Simple as that..

The theoretical framework underlying the enhanced edition aligns with constructivist learning theories, which highlight that learners actively construct knowledge through experience and reflection rather than passively receiving information. Interactive elements such as drag-and-drop exercises, virtual dissections, and problem-solving activities encourage active engagement with the material, promoting deeper understanding and better retention But it adds up..

Additionally, the enhanced PDF incorporates principles of multimedia learning theory, developed by researchers like Richard Mayer. These principles suggest that people learn better from words and pictures together than from words alone, that extraneous material can interfere with learning, and that meaningful learning occurs when learners can organize and integrate new information with existing knowledge structures. The enhanced edition's design reflects these insights through carefully curated multimedia content, clear navigation, and scaffolded learning experiences that build complexity gradually Small thing, real impact..
